Main attack + system + two male protagonists.
The middle two stinky attack vs the straight ball fox shou.
Because the article he wrote was unfinished, Wei Chao was caught by System 021 and sent to repair the world.
But no one told him that repairing the world = comforting the love brain system + taking care of the socially anxious child + a final essay on cultivating immortality!
